A friend of mine, who has grown this for years, has never had a problem producing sensimilla. However, this time around, it appears that there are seeds, but we are thinking they are false seed pods.

The last picture is a feminized Bubbleicious from Nirvana, the first and second is supposedly Chocolate Chunk that was received from a friend. He looked for male flowers on the feminized seeds, but he can't find a single male pollen sac. So, if these are seeds, he has no idea how they got pollinated. He squeezed one and a ton of clear stuff came out (water?).

They are in a tent with temperatures floating around 75F degrees during light and 65-70F at night. They were on a feed/flush schedule, with feeding occurring once every other week and flushes in between.

They are on day 56 from when their cotyledons appeared. Hairs are turning brown/yellow and everything looks very juicy and delicious. Trichomes are cloudy/clear with a few ambers here and there.

Looking for some advice...thanks.

kinda looks like your girl got prego :-/ you will know for sure in a couple weeks or so. I had a plant go hermie and it polinated itself and 1 other... looked kinda like that... take some tweezers on a smaller bud that has them and kinda pinch the tip of the "pod" and see if anything is in it.
 
I just wish I knew where the pollen came from. He cleaned out the tent with soap and water before putting more plants in there. Didn't clean the fan, though. There are a couple other plants that haven't been pollinated. Definitely no male flowers in there, though. No hermies, either.

I wanted to update the thread a little bit for some resolution.

The plants turned out to have a decent amount of seeds on them. I think he counted at least 50 to 75 seeds. He went through and picked them out with tweezers after harvest (which was on Saturday). Hopefully the buds will still be quality.

He isn't sure how they were fertilized. He has only grown from feminized seed before and has never had a hermaphrodite. Before the grow, the tent was scrubbed with soap and water to clean it out. This is sure a mystery.
 
That's strange man- I would germ 5-10 of the beans and see how many come out male/female. If you have all females then your likely culprit is a hermie flower that popped up, if you get an even mix then it is either from a plant nearby (possibly outside) or it might have been from smoking a weed with seeds, then working on the plants.
